Nagpanchami Pleasing The Snake God

On Nag Panchami – Shravan Shukla Panchami, we worship Nag Devtas as guardians of water, fertility, and family protection, and as dear to Lord Shiva. How to please Nag Devta – Puja Vidhi This is what is traditionally done at hme:

Preparation : Wake up early, take bath, wear clean clothes. Clean your puja room / altar with water or Gangajal. Keep a fast if you can – many eat only once in the evening. Place a red cloth on a wooden chowki and keep an idol or picture of Nag Devta. Idol can be of silver, stone, wood, or clay.

Puja : First bathe the idol with water and raw milk, then with water again.

Offerings: milk mixed with honey, ghee and sugar, turmeric, kumkum / roli, akshat (raw rice), flowers (especially white), incense and ghee diya. Offer sweets and seasonal fruits.

Do Sankalpa – vow that you are performing puja with sincere devotion.

Prayers and Katha : Light diya and agarbatti, fold hands and pray for family welfare. Recite Nag Panchami katha and mantra, then do aarti.

Mantras to recite

The most common mantras:

Sarpa Mantra:

Anantam Vasukim Shesham Padmanabham cha Kambalam
Shankhapalam Dhritarashtram cha Takshakam Kaliyam tatha
Etani nava namani Naganaam cha Mahatmanam
Sayam kale pathennityam pratah kale visheshatah
Tasya vishabhayam nasti sarvatra vijayi bhavet

Meaning – remembering the nine great Nagas removes fear of poison and brings victory.

Sarve Nagaah Mantra:

Sarve Nagaah preeyantam me ye kechit prithvi-tale
Ye cha helimarchi-stha ye cha divi-stha ye antariksha-stha
Ye nadeeshu mahanaga ye saraswati-gaminah
Ye cha vapi-tadageshu teshu sarveshu vai namah

“May the snakes who are in this world, sky, heaven, sun-rays, lakes, wells, ponds etc. bless us and we all salute them.”

Chant at least 108 times or 11 times with devotion.

What pleases them most

Ahimsa: Do not kill or hurt snakes on this day. Respect live snakes, anthills (Nag Bhanda / Varul) where they are believed to live. Don’t dig the earth – tradition says avoid ploughing, digging or cutting trees on Nag Panchami. Feed symbolically: Offer milk to stone/clay idols. If you visit a live Nag temple, don’t force-feed milk – it harms them. Offer flowers and pray from distance.Worship Shiva: Abhishek of Shivling with milk and water, as Nagas are his ornaments. Charity: Offer food, clothes to poor, and avoid iron tawa / fried food if your family tradition says so. After puja, sprinkle some puja milk and flowers near a Tulsi plant or sacred tree, and break your fast after listening to the Katha.
